Garden Harmony: Integrating Fencing into Your Landscape Design Aesthetic
Start by assessing your landscape design goals. Is your objective to create a private oasis, establish boundaries, or simply add an artistic touch to your outdoor space? Your goals will guide your choices in materials, style, and placement. Material selection is a crucial step in integrating fencing into your landscape. Consider your garden's overall style and existing materials. For a rustic look, wood fences can add warmth and charm, blending seamlessly with surrounding greenery. If your garden leans towards a modern aesthetic, metal or composite materials with sleek lines might be the perfect choice. The color of your fence can either make it a standout feature or an elegant backdrop. A white picket fence can evoke a classic, cottage-like feel, whereas darker tones can provide a dramatic contrast to vibrant blooms. Natural wood finishes lend a timeless, organic quality to gardens. Use paint or stain to complement your landscape’s palette, ensuring harmony throughout your outdoor space.
The design of your fence should reflect both your personal style and the architectural elements of your home. If your house has traditional details, consider intricate, decorative fencing patterns that echo these motifs. For contemporary homes, minimalist designs with clean lines can enhance your garden's modern aesthetic. Incorporating plants and vegetation alongside your fence can further blend your structures into the landscape. Climbing plants like jasmine or ivy can create a living wall effect, adding layers of texture and color. Installing planters or garden beds near your fence allows for seasonal flexibility and can soften the look of more rigid fences. Staggering taller plants or shrubs in front of your fence can also provide depth and privacy.
Don’t overlook the functional aspects of fencing. A well-placed fence can serve as a windbreak, reduce noise pollution, and provide a safe enclosure for pets and children. By considering these practical benefits, you ensure your fence fulfills multiple purposes while enhancing your garden's design.
Finally, attention to detail can make a significant difference in the overall harmony of your landscape. Choose hardware and accessories that complement the style of your fencing and garden. Decorative hinges, finials, or post caps can add unique touches that reflect your personality. Lighting is another critical aspect; install subtle or solar-powered lights to illuminate your fence, extending garden enjoyment into the night.
